MSSQL(Microsoft SQL Server)是一种性能优越的专业的结构化查询语言,通常被用于贮存和管理联系数据库。在MSSQL中,有一个称为“慢速现象”的现象,它会给一些人带来一定的困扰,下面就来了解下MSSQL中下午慢个不停的缘由及解决方法。
首先,缘由是MSSQL服务器在下午搜索数据时,会遇到碎片,这些碎片会致使查询速度变慢。碎片的存在会使索引被浪费,这会致使数据库的运行变慢,也会影响查询的性能。其次,如果设置的自动增长值太小,数据库的操作也会变慢,这也是MSSQL下午缓慢的缘由之一。
荣幸的是,如果我们发现MSSQL服务器慢查,我们也具有一些可以用来解决这个问题的方法。
首先说,可使用DBCC检查语句来重组表格,它可以清算程序中的碎片,使索引变得更加顺畅,从而缩短搜索数据时的时间。代码以下:
DBCC INDEXDEFRAG(DATABASE_NAME,TABLE_NAME,INDEX_NAME)
在设置自动增长值问题上,我们也能够尝试调剂自动增长值大小,使之更合适查询数据时的要求。我们可以用以下代码来设置自动增长值:
ALTER DATABASE [DATABASE_NAME] MODIFY FILE (Name = LOGICAL_FILE_NAME, FILEGROWTH = SIZE_MB)
总之,MSSQL下午慢不停是一个很常见的情况,可使用DBCC检查语句重组表格和调剂自动增长值大小来解决这个问题。实行这些改变以后,MSSQL服务器的查询效力就可以够得到有效的提高。
本文来源:https://www.yuntue.com/post/224758.html | 云服务器网,转载请注明出处!

微信扫一扫打赏
支付宝扫一扫打赏